April weather at Lido Beach, United States showcases a delightful blend of warmth and occasional showers. With a maximum temperature reaching 25°C (77°F) and an average of 10°C (50°F), visitors can enjoy mild days while basking in coastal beauty. However, the month is also characterized by minimum temperatures dipping to 0°C (32°F), so layering is advisable. Rainfall totals 126 mm (5.0 in) over approximately 12 days, contributing to the area's lush landscapes, while a humidity level of 78% adds to the tropical vibe. April Temperature in Lido Beach

April in Lido Beach brings a refreshing transition from the chill of winter, with temperatures rising noticeably. The minimum temperature starts at a brisk 0°C (32°F), while the average warms up to a comfortable 10°C (50°F), peaking at a pleasant 25°C (77°F). This marks a significant increase from March, where highs reached just 22°C (72°F). April Precipitation in Lido Beach

In April, Lido Beach experiences a moderate precipitation level of 126 mm (5.0 in), consistent with the rainfall seen in March and the following month, May. With 12 rainy days, April maintains a balance that hints at spring’s rejuvenating arrival, offering a smooth segue into the summer season. April Humidity in Lido Beach

In April, Lido Beach experiences a noticeable shift in humidity as it dips to 78%, marking a welcome change from the higher levels of the previous months. This gradual decline in moisture begins with the new year’s 84% in January, falling steadily through 82% in February and 81% in March. The decrease in April suggests a transition towards the drier months ahead, with humidity continuing to drop further to 69% in May and June. UV Risk Categories

  •  Extreme (11+): Avoid the sun, stay in shade.
  •  Very High (8-10): Limit sun exposure.
  •  High (6-7): Use SPF 30+ and protective clothing.
  •  Moderate (3-5): Midday shade recommended.
  •  Low (0-2): No protection needed.
